Overview

A Chichen Itza Classic tour that includes all you need for the perfect Mayan ruins excursion from Cancun. Travel back in time and learn more about the ancient Mayan civilization at the archaeological site of Chichen Itzá with an expert guide. Swim in a sacred cenote in the Yucatan and savor a delicious buffet lunch of Yucatan cuisine. Enjoy a little free time in the “Pueblo Magico” of Valladolid and admire the zocalo and San Servacio church. This Chichen Itza tour is the ideal way to explore the Mayan world.

Chichen Itza
The enigmatic Mayan ruins of Chichen Itza are a must visit when traveling in Cancun and the Riviera Maya. This fascinating archaeological site is one of the New Seven Wonders of the World and is a designated UNESCO World Heritage Site. It is an important site that will teach you all about the ancient Maya people and their culture, history and mythology. Your tour is led by certified bilingual guides who will bring you back in time with their tales and expertise in the structures of the site.
